Help with SPS
 
I have 2 SPS frags both Montipora Digitata. They seem to be growing but they never extend their polyps. I have had one for about 7 weeks and the other for 6. My water parameters are all good
Ammonia 0.0
Nitrites 0.0
Nitrates <10
CA 420
PH 8.3
dKH 10.8
SG 1.024
Temp 79-82
They are under 2x250W 6500K MH with 2x110 03Actinics in a 75G tank. I have adjust my PH so that flow is strong but not crazy on both.

Any suggestions would be great

When strong currents blow them they seem to close up try lower flow and lower light. They aren't as light/current demanding as other SPS.

Maybe lower your nitrates.
